欧文·韦斯特与美国西部神话

《欧文·韦斯特与美国西部神话》主要内容为Huarong Wang's examination of Owen Wister and his seminal novel will enlighten readers in China about how simple heroic tales set in exotic frontier locations in the United States became an aspect of nationalistic idealism.The “cowboy hero” had existed in American popular fiction before Wister's Virginian, but the cultural influence of this figure took on greater significance because of his representation in the novel-and later in Holly-wood films and television series. As Huarong Wang explains in this fascinating study, the myth of the American West took shape before Wister wrote his fictional tale, but once his hero rode into the popular imagination, the power of this mythology increased and galloped ahead throughout the twentieth century. This well crafted, thoughtful book contributes to our ongoing interest in the significance of stories that can reveal larger cultural issues and influence national identity.
